Antonio Conte was 'disappointed' Chelsea didn't take home all three points from their 2-2 draw with Arsenal.
Hector Bellerin scored an equaliser in stoppage time to give Arsenal a share of the spoils.
The Blues had plenty of chances to score throughout the match, with Alvaro Morata missing three one-on-one opportunities. And speaking after the contest, Conte couldn't withhold his despondency.
"I think it is a pity because when you have so many chances to score you must win the game," said Conte.
"Instead we are talking about a draw against a good team, but in this game we deserved to win as we created a lot of chances.
"We must be disappointed, we had a great chance to win, but we must accept the final result. We win together, we lose together, we draw together."
Chelsea now remain in third place, one point behind Manchester United.
